<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Influence of Global Trends</h2>

One of the most significant factors shaping the fashion choices of Vietnamese students is the influence of global trends. With the advent of the internet and social media, students are now more connected than ever to the global fashion scene. They draw inspiration from international celebrities, fashion influencers, and popular culture, incorporating elements of these styles into their own. This has led to a surge in the popularity of streetwear, athleisure, and minimalist styles among Vietnamese students.

<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Role of Traditional Vietnamese Fashion</h2>

Despite the strong influence of global trends, traditional Vietnamese fashion still holds a significant place in the hearts of students. The Ao Dai, a traditional Vietnamese dress, is often worn by students during special occasions and cultural events. This blend of traditional and modern fashion reflects the unique cultural identity of Vietnamese students, demonstrating their respect for their heritage while embracing global influences.

<h2 style="font-weight: bold; margin: 12px 0;">The Impact of Sustainability on Fashion Choices</h2>

In recent years, sustainability has become a key concern in the fashion industry, and this has not gone unnoticed by Vietnamese students. Many are now opting for sustainable fashion choices, such as buying second-hand clothes or choosing brands that prioritize ethical manufacturing practices. This shift towards sustainable fashion reflects a growing awareness among Vietnamese students about the environmental impact of their fashion choices.
